OpenAI Launches GPT-6 Astra for Computer Use and Complex Work

OpenAI is rolling out GPT-6 Astra, a new model aimed at computer use, browsing, software engineering, cybersecurity, science, and professional work. The rollout starts with a limited set of organizations and is planned to expand to ChatGPT Plus, Pro, Business, and Enterprise users, as well as the OpenAI API, Microsoft Azure, and AWS Bedrock. (OpenAI on X; OpenAI)
The launch is a meaningful workflow update rather than only a model-name change. OpenAI describes Astra as a model that can operate across multistep computer tasks, create and edit professional documents, and combine reasoning with tool use. (OpenAI; OpenAI Help Center)
What Astra is designed to do
OpenAI positions Astra as a general-purpose model for work that crosses reasoning and execution. Its launch examples include:
- Filling out online forms and updating records in a CRM.
- Researching online and drafting summaries in email or document editors.
- Analyzing scientific data and generating plots.
- Creating a website and checking its frontend behavior.
- Installing and testing software, then troubleshooting what appears on screen.
- Producing documents, spreadsheets, and presentations that follow a user's templates and instructions.
The official announcement also describes Astra as an advance in computer use and browser use, with the model able to adapt when requirements change during a task. (OpenAI; OpenAI Help Center)
Rollout and access
Astra is initially rolling out to a limited set of organizations. OpenAI's release notes say it is not yet generally available, with broader availability planned over the coming days. (OpenAI Help Center)
OpenAI's launch announcement names these planned surfaces:
- ChatGPT Plus, Pro, Business, and Enterprise.
- The OpenAI API.
- Microsoft Azure.
- AWS Bedrock.
Astra usage is included within existing ChatGPT subscription allowances, according to OpenAI. Users and businesses will also be able to purchase additional usage credits, while Pro, Business, and Enterprise plans are slated to receive GPT-6 Astra Pro. Enterprise administrators can enable Astra for their workspace; OpenAI says access is off by default at launch. (OpenAI)
For API developers, the model identifier is gpt-6-astra. OpenAI lists Standard API pricing at $10 per million input tokens and $50 per million output tokens, with separate rates for cache reads and writes. Fast mode targets up to twice the speed of Standard processing at twice the Standard price. (OpenAI)
Capability signals, with the right caveat
OpenAI reports that Astra is state-of-the-art on several internal and public evaluations, including a 98% score on FrontierMath Tier 4, 99.9% on ARC-AGI-3, and 100% on ExploitBench. It also reports a 72.6% score on OSWorld 2.0 at roughly 40 minutes per task, compared with 65.7% at roughly 75 minutes for GPT-5.6 Sol in the cited latency simulation. These are OpenAI-reported results, not independent comparative testing. (OpenAI)
The practical takeaway is that Astra is intended for longer workflows where the model must inspect a screen, use tools, and produce a finished artifact instead of returning only text. Teams should still test their own tasks, especially where a workflow can change data, send messages, or make external commitments.
Safety and monitoring
OpenAI describes Astra as its first model to reach the Critical cybersecurity capability level under its Preparedness Framework. The safety overview says that, with the right tools and access, the model can find previously unknown security flaws and develop exploit paths across well-protected systems. (OpenAI safety overview)
That capability comes with additional controls. OpenAI says Astra is externally deployed with misalignment monitoring across tool-using inference, and its release notes describe monitoring that can pause or stop a conversation when the model may not have interpreted instructions correctly. Users may then review the situation before proceeding. (OpenAI safety overview; OpenAI Help Center)
OpenAI also says eligible API customers can use Zero Data Retention, and that Private Safety Processing is being tested to strengthen safety monitoring while preserving customer privacy. The safety overview separately notes that Astra's monitorability is lower than GPT-5.6 Sol in some adversarial evaluations, so the launch should not be read as a claim that monitoring eliminates all risk. (OpenAI; OpenAI safety overview)
What builders should check first
Before putting Astra into a production workflow, builders should verify:
- Whether their ChatGPT workspace or API organization is included in the current rollout.
- Which platform has the features they need: ChatGPT, the OpenAI API, Azure, or Bedrock.
- Whether the workflow needs standard or Fast API processing, and how cache pricing applies.
- How pauses, reviews, and monitoring interact with long-running tool calls.
- What data-retention and administrator controls apply to their deployment.
GPT-6 Astra is therefore both a model launch and an access change: it brings a more execution-oriented model to OpenAI's product and developer surfaces, but availability remains staged and the safety controls are part of the product behavior.
